A Level 2 electrician holds a distinct and essential role within the electrical market. Unlike general electricians who concentrate on internal wiring and home appliance installation, Level 2 specialists are licensed to work directly on the service network-- the lines that connect premises to the primary power grid. This includes everything from the pole to the meter box, including overhead and underground service lines, and even the installation of brand-new service mains. Their work is frequently outdoors, exposed to the aspects, and requires a profound understanding of network guidelines and security protocols.
Ending up being a Level 2 electrician is no little accomplishment. It requires years of fundamental electrical experience, usually gained as a certified electrician, followed by specialized training and rigorous assessments. This sophisticated training covers locations such as overhead line work, underground cabling, metering setups, and network safety procedures. The different accreditations within Level 2 allow for various scopes of work. For instance, some might concentrate on disconnections and reconnections, while others are qualified to install and fix underground service lines, and even carry out more intricate tasks like updating service capability for bigger residential or commercial properties.
One of the most typical reasons a property owner may hire a Level 2 electrician is for a service upgrade. As homes age or as electricity usage increases with the addition of air conditioning, heated swimming pools, or charging stations for electric vehicles, the existing electrical infrastructure might end up being insufficient. A Level 2 expert examines the current capability, creates an appropriate upgrade, and after that masterfully changes or enhances the service mains to satisfy the brand-new demands, ensuring the property has a safe and reputable power supply.
Another important service provided is the connection of website new properties to the grid. Whether it's a new develop or a granny flat being contributed to an existing property, the preliminary connection to the network falls squarely within the Level 2 scope. This involves communicating with the energy service provider, installing the needed metering equipment, and guaranteeing all work complies with rigid safety and regulative standards before the power can be formally turned on.
The expansion of renewable energy sources has likewise considerably expanded the role of Level 2 electricians. With more homes and organizations setting up solar photovoltaic systems, these experts are often hired to install clever meters or carry out service upgrades to accommodate the two-way flow of electrical power. Their knowledge guarantees that these green energy options are perfectly incorporated into the existing grid, allowing for efficient energy production and intake.
Safety is, naturally, vital in all electrical work, but especially so when dealing with live network connections. Level 2 electricians are carefully trained in danger assessment, lockout/tagout treatments, and operating at heights or in confined areas. They are equipped with specialized individual protective devices (PPE) and abide by strict industry standards to reduce hazards. Their deep understanding of network diagrams and fault finding is important for rapidly and securely resolving power failures or electrical issues that stem at the service point.
Furthermore, these knowledgeable tradespeople play a vital role in keeping the integrity and reliability of the electrical network. They are often the very first responders to downed power lines, damaged service mains, or defective meters, working vigilantly to bring back power and make sure the safety of the neighborhood. Their fast action and analytical capabilities are essential in decreasing disruption and making sure a continuous supply of electrical energy.
